数控编程大炮的编程技巧

数控大炮的编程过程是一种复杂的技术操作,需要掌握专业的编程知识和操作技巧。下面我为您总结了数控大炮编程的主要步骤和注意事项,希望对您有所帮助。

在开始编程之前,首先要了解大炮的结构特点和主要技术参数,包括炮管长度、炮管口径、弹道特性等。这些信息将直接影响到编程过程中的各项设置。同时还要充分掌握大炮的运动轨迹和控制方式,合理设计程序路径。

常见的数控大炮编程软件包括Mastercam、EdgeCAM、Vericut等。这些软件具有强大的仿真功能,可以帮助您提前预览程序运行效果,检查可能存在的问题。在选择软件时,要结合自身需求和使用习惯进行选择。

主程序是整个编程的核心部分,需要包含大炮的各项运动控制指令,如炮管仰角、左右转角、炮管升降等。编程时要注意运动指令的先后顺序,确保各项动作协调一致,避免干涉碰撞。同时还要考虑程序的鲁棒性,设置合理的保护机制。

除了主程序之外,还需要编写一些辅助程序,如装填程序、瞄准程序等。这些程序负责完成大炮的准备工作,为主程序的执行创造条件。编写时要注意各程序之间的协调配合,确保整个作业流程顺畅进行。

在完成程序编写后,一定要进行仿真测试,检查程序是否存在问题。这个步骤非常重要,可以避免在实际作业中出现意外情况。仿真测试时要设置各种工况条件,确保程序具备良好的适应性和鲁棒性。

最后一步是将程序上传到大炮控制系统,进行现场调试。这个阶段可能会发现一些程序细节问题,需要进行适当的修改和优化。调试时要注意安全操作,并做好相关记录,为今后使用提供参考。

总之,数控大炮的编程是一项复杂的技术工作,需要丰富的专业知识和实践经验。希望以上内容对您有所帮助,如果还有其他问题,欢迎随时与我交流。

免责声明:本网站部分内容由用户自行上传,若侵犯了您的权益,请联系我们处理,谢谢!

分享:

扫一扫在手机阅读、分享本文